NSMBW character mod now live

This commit is contained in:
Christopher Roy Bratusek 2015-07-12 19:59:08 +02:00
parent 65028ee575
commit 3f1cf46841
2 changed files with 5 additions and 5 deletions

View File

@ -252,8 +252,9 @@ check_input_image_mkwiimm () {
show_nsmb_db () { show_nsmb_db () {
ID=${1:0:6} ID1=${1:0:3}
gawk -F \: "/^${ID}/"'{print $2}' \ ID2=${1:4:2}
gawk -F \: "/^${ID1}\*${ID2}/"'{print $2}' \
< ${PATCHIMAGE_SCRIPT_DIR}/nsmbw.db || echo "** Unknown **" < ${PATCHIMAGE_SCRIPT_DIR}/nsmbw.db || echo "** Unknown **"
} }
@ -288,7 +289,7 @@ ask_input_image_nsmb () {
ALL patch all images" ALL patch all images"
for image in ${1}/MSN???.{iso,wbfs}; do for image in ${1}/SMN???.{iso,wbfs} ${1}/SLF???.{iso,wbfs} ${1}/SMM???.{iso,wbfs} ${1}/SMV???.{iso,wbfs} ${1}/MRR???.{iso,wbfs}; do
if [[ -e ${image} ]]; then if [[ -e ${image} ]]; then
echo " ${image##*/} $(show_nsmb_db ${image##*/})" echo " ${image##*/} $(show_nsmb_db ${image##*/})"
fi fi

View File

@ -64,10 +64,9 @@ pi_action () {
&& exit 57) && exit 57)
fi fi
slot=$(gawk -F \: "/^${player}/"'{print $2}' ${PATCHIMAGE_SCRIPT_DIR}/nsmbw_characters.db) slot=$(gawk -F \: "/^${player}/"'{print $2}' ${PATCHIMAGE_SCRIPT_DIR}/nsmbw_characters.db)
choosenplayers=( ${choosenplayers[@]} player:${slot} ) choosenplayers=( ${choosenplayers[@]} ${player}:${slot} )
done done
echo ${choosenplayers[@]} echo ${choosenplayers[@]}
echo "choosenplayers=( ${choosenplayers[@]} )" > ${HOME}/.patchimage.choice echo "choosenplayers=( ${choosenplayers[@]} )" > ${HOME}/.patchimage.choice
fi fi